We take time out from daily tasks and routine to sit quietly together. Zen meditation allows the mind to settle down and become still, learning to develop focus and clear-eyed acceptance of ourselves and others. The direction of our practice is to pay attention to the present moment and use this awareness and energy to help all beings. Please join us.

When you completely focus on whatever you are doing, wherever you are, both when meditating and in daily life, this is Zen.

If you want to get a feeling for how practicing Zen can help your life please read or listen to this poem entitled Hokusai Says by the late Roger Keyes, Ph.D. Roger was a long-time Zen practitioner and co-founder of York Zen. He is internationally recognized as an expert on Japanese woodblock prints, especially those by Hokusai. Hokusai is best known for his print The Great Wave.
